What is RESPECT?

RESPECT is Africa’s Digital Public Infrastructure for Education—a digital library for EdTech apps that makes quality educational technology accessible, sustainable, and scalable across the continent.

What does "RESPECT Compatible" mean?

RESPECT Compatible™ apps meet our interoperable technical standards: they work across borders, support offline functionality, maintain data sovereignty, and provide quality educational content aligned with local curricula.

Is RESPECT free to use?

For learners and educators, yes—RESPECT Compatible apps are free to access. For developers, RESPECT provides a sponsor-supported revenue model that creates sustainable income whilst keeping education free for end users.

How does RESPECT protect learner data?

RESPECT is built on data sovereignty principles. Countries maintain full control of learner data, which remains within their jurisdiction under their data protection laws. We provide infrastructure for insights whilst honouring national sovereignty.

How can my app become RESPECT Compatible?

Review our developer documentation to understand our technical standards, then submit your app for certification. Our team provides guidance throughout the process.
